  11. class Template(object):
  12. """Represents a compiled template.
  13. :class:`.Template` includes a reference to the original
  14. template source (via the :attr:`.source` attribute)
  15. as well as the source code of the
  16. generated Python module (i.e. the :attr:`.code` attribute),
  17. as well as a reference to an actual Python module.
  18. :class:`.Template` is constructed using either a literal string
  19. representing the template text, or a filename representing a filesystem
  20. path to a source file.
  21. :param text: textual template source. This argument is mutually
  22. exclusive versus the ``filename`` parameter.
  23. :param filename: filename of the source template. This argument is
  24. mutually exclusive versus the ``text`` parameter.
  25. :param buffer_filters: string list of filters to be applied
  26. to the output of ``%def``\ s which are buffered, cached, or otherwise
  27. filtered, after all filters
  28. defined with the ``%def`` itself have been applied. Allows the
  29. creation of default expression filters that let the output
  30. of return-valued ``%def``\ s "opt out" of that filtering via
  31. passing special attributes or objects.
  32. :param bytestring_passthrough: When ``True``, and ``output_encoding`` is
  33. set to ``None``, and :meth:`.Template.render` is used to render,
  34. the `StringIO` or `cStringIO` buffer will be used instead of the
  35. default "fast" buffer. This allows raw bytestrings in the
  36. output stream, such as in expressions, to pass straight
  37. through to the buffer. This flag is forced
  38. to ``True`` if ``disable_unicode`` is also configured.
  39. .. versionadded:: 0.4
  40. Added to provide the same behavior as that of the previous series.
  41. :param cache_args: Dictionary of cache configuration arguments that
  42. will be passed to the :class:`.CacheImpl`. See :ref:`caching_toplevel`.
  43. :param cache_dir:
  44. .. deprecated:: 0.6
  45. Use the ``'dir'`` argument in the ``cache_args`` dictionary.
  46. See :ref:`caching_toplevel`.
  47. :param cache_enabled: Boolean flag which enables caching of this
  48. template. See :ref:`caching_toplevel`.
  49. :param cache_impl: String name of a :class:`.CacheImpl` caching
  50. implementation to use. Defaults to ``'beaker'``.
  51. :param cache_type:
  52. .. deprecated:: 0.6
  53. Use the ``'type'`` argument in the ``cache_args`` dictionary.
  54. See :ref:`caching_toplevel`.
  55. :param cache_url:
  56. .. deprecated:: 0.6
  57. Use the ``'url'`` argument in the ``cache_args`` dictionary.
  58. See :ref:`caching_toplevel`.
  59. :param default_filters: List of string filter names that will
  60. be applied to all expressions. See :ref:`filtering_default_filters`.
  61. :param disable_unicode: Disables all awareness of Python Unicode
  62. objects. See :ref:`unicode_disabled`.
  63. :param enable_loop: When ``True``, enable the ``loop`` context variable.
  64. This can be set to ``False`` to support templates that may
  65. be making usage of the name "``loop``". Individual templates can
  66. re-enable the "loop" context by placing the directive
  67. ``enable_loop="True"`` inside the ``<%page>`` tag -- see
  68. :ref:`migrating_loop`.
  69. :param encoding_errors: Error parameter passed to ``encode()`` when
  70. string encoding is performed. See :ref:`usage_unicode`.
  71. :param error_handler: Python callable which is called whenever
  72. compile or runtime exceptions occur. The callable is passed
  73. the current context as well as the exception. If the
  74. callable returns ``True``, the exception is considered to
  75. be handled, else it is re-raised after the function
  76. completes. Is used to provide custom error-rendering
  77. functions.
  78. :param format_exceptions: if ``True``, exceptions which occur during
  79. the render phase of this template will be caught and
  80. formatted into an HTML error page, which then becomes the
  81. rendered result of the :meth:`.render` call. Otherwise,
  82. runtime exceptions are propagated outwards.
  83. :param imports: String list of Python statements, typically individual
  84. "import" lines, which will be placed into the module level
  85. preamble of all generated Python modules. See the example
  86. in :ref:`filtering_default_filters`.
  87. :param input_encoding: Encoding of the template's source code. Can
  88. be used in lieu of the coding comment. See
  89. :ref:`usage_unicode` as well as :ref:`unicode_toplevel` for
  90. details on source encoding.
  91. :param lookup: a :class:`.TemplateLookup` instance that will be used
  92. for all file lookups via the ``<%namespace>``,
  93. ``<%include>``, and ``<%inherit>`` tags. See
  94. :ref:`usage_templatelookup`.
  95. :param module_directory: Filesystem location where generated
  96. Python module files will be placed.
  97. :param module_filename: Overrides the filename of the generated
  98. Python module file. For advanced usage only.
  99. :param module_writer: A callable which overrides how the Python
  100. module is written entirely. The callable is passed the
  101. encoded source content of the module and the destination
  102. path to be written to. The default behavior of module writing
  103. uses a tempfile in conjunction with a file move in order
  104. to make the operation atomic. So a user-defined module
  105. writing function that mimics the default behavior would be:
  106. .. sourcecode:: python
  107. import tempfile
  108. import os
  109. import shutil
  110. def module_writer(source, outputpath):
  111. (dest, name) = \\
  112. tempfile.mkstemp(
  113. dir=os.path.dirname(outputpath)
  114. )
  115. os.write(dest, source)
  116. os.close(dest)
  117. shutil.move(name, outputpath)
  118. from mako.template import Template
  119. mytemplate = Template(
  120. file="index.html",
  121. module_directory="/path/to/modules",
  122. module_writer=module_writer
  123. )
  124. The function is provided for unusual configurations where
  125. certain platform-specific permissions or other special
  126. steps are needed.
  127. :param output_encoding: The encoding to use when :meth:`.render`
  128. is called.
  129. See :ref:`usage_unicode` as well as :ref:`unicode_toplevel`.
  130. :param preprocessor: Python callable which will be passed
  131. the full template source before it is parsed. The return
  132. result of the callable will be used as the template source
  133. code.
  134. :param strict_undefined: Replaces the automatic usage of
  135. ``UNDEFINED`` for any undeclared variables not located in
  136. the :class:`.Context` with an immediate raise of
  137. ``NameError``. The advantage is immediate reporting of
  138. missing variables which include the name.
  139. .. versionadded:: 0.3.6
  140. :param uri: string URI or other identifier for this template.
  141. If not provided, the ``uri`` is generated from the filesystem
  142. path, or from the in-memory identity of a non-file-based
  143. template. The primary usage of the ``uri`` is to provide a key
  144. within :class:`.TemplateLookup`, as well as to generate the
  145. file path of the generated Python module file, if
  146. ``module_directory`` is specified.
  147. """
